The Bramblefort registry enforces exact-version pinning for all production dependencies; floating ranges are rejected at publish time. Teams must refresh pins through the Coppervale resolver, which validates checksums against the internal mirror before approval. Queries to the resolver require authentication on every request. For this week's sync demo, use the resolver key provided below.

API key for yahig-tadup: kto7_ubizbYm

### Step 4 — Configure Prunewick credentials

Before promoting the Prunewick stale-branch bot to production, verify that `prunewick.env` on the deploy host matches the checked-in template. Confirm `PW_DRY_RUN` is set to `false` only after the staging sweep has been reviewed, and that `PW_RETENTION_DAYS` matches the policy agreed with the platform team (currently 45).

The bot authenticates against the Marlowe Git mirror using a service credential. Append it on the line below:

env line for fafof-fahag: LEDGER_TOKEN5=f8790

## Configuration

Huskwire registry reads all settings from the environment. Set HUSK_PORT, HUSK_STORE_PATH, and HUSK_COMPAT_MODE before boot. Schema validation is strict by default; disable only in tests. Compatibility checks run against the upstream event catalog maintained by the Fenholt platform group, which requires an access credential. Without it, the registry starts in read-only mode. Append this line to .env.

env line for kageg-fajof: COURIER_KEY5=93d14